steftolbert 's review for:
The Pirate's Wife: The Remarkable Story of Mrs. Captain Kidd
by Daphne Palmer Geanacopoulos
I got suckered in by the idea of learning about a pirate’s wife. Everything was “she may have” or “she would likely” sort of conjecture. There really wasn’t enough sources to make a real biography. But parts were interesting, although I could have done without the lengthy listings of physical inventory people owned.
